I've tried with no luck

The problem is that i cant connect my P900 to my PC as a modem, ive tried everything, tried to uncheck the COM 6 (the one i use for USB connection and works for everything else) in the "Phone Connection Link" and check it the the "Phone Monitor" as it says when i open the " Dial-up Networking wizard", also i have selected the modem option in the control panel in the P900 but the wizard keeps telling me that there isnt a phone connected.

I want to connect using my gprs data account (as i used to do in my T610) and no dial any number.

Any help would be very apreciated

Gigs Posts: > 500

try this:

Disable the com port the cable is intalled in on both the phone connection link and the phone monitor options.

Go into your modems control panel, add the modem (don't detect it ) and add the serial driver. Select the "all ports" reference and you should be able to choose the com port the cable is on.

Once done, go back, enable it in Phone Monitor Options and make sure phone is switched to modem.. and continue on from there

Hopefully that'll work.
